Ticket: Staging env misconfigured for Siftgate bloom filter

The bloom layer in front of the Pellet KV store is rejecting all lookups in staging because the env file was copied from the dev template without credentials. False-positive tuning values are fine; only the auth line is missing. To unblock the weekly demo, the Pellet admission secret must be set on the following line.

env line for yaguf-fajop: LEDGER_TOKEN13=fb08984397349

Hey — before you can review my branch, heads up: the Brimworth secrets vault that holds the QueueLift scaling tokens locked itself again after the cert rotation. The autoscaler reads queue-depth metrics from Pondermill, and without the vault open, the integration tests just hang, so don't blame your review env. I already pinged the platform folks; they said any reviewer can unseal it themselves. Pop open the vault CLI, pick the QueueLift realm, and paste in the recovery passphrase below.

vault phrase of tagaf-hawef = jordor-wenok-gorael-wenion-keleth-sorion-wenys-novix-fenir-fraax-fenael-aldius-fraok

# Service Accounts: tailcat CLI

For the weekly sync: tailcat, our internal log-tailing CLI, now uses dedicated service accounts instead of personal tokens. One account per team. Accounts get read-only access to their team's log streams, nothing else. Rotation is quarterly, automated. Do not share accounts across teams; quota tracking depends on it. Provisioning requests go through the platform queue. The shared demo account for the sync walkthrough authenticates with the key below.

API key for yahig-tadup: kto7_ubizbYm

Ticket #4471 — ChipGate reader auth failing at Larkspur Marathon staging. The timing-chip readers from our StrideSync fleet stopped syncing splits to the central board at 06:12. Root cause: the service credential the readers use against the ResultsHub ingest endpoint expired overnight. Runners hit mat checkpoints fine; data just queues locally. Rotate before Saturday's race or we lose live tracking. New credential minted and verified against staging. Use the key below.

API key for hahag-kafof: vxb3-kck